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
82556439 3589225 9356959111
20035915472 589534
20035915472 589534
198 1879213 411857 6480536 69
All about undefined
Interested in learning more?
20035915472 589534
198 1879213 411857 6480536 69
See more
17664410571 023762085
46 3720 3780
See more
217 1672008
909676 6571 8113 6793317
See more